Weightless meaning in Urdu
Weightless Sentence
Weightless Definitions
1) Weightless : بے وزن : (adjective) having little or no weight or apparent gravitational pull; light.
A baby bat...fluffy and weightless as a moth.
Jackets made of a weightless polyester fabric.
